Ulithi is one of the western Caroline Islands, which lie in the Pacific Ocean. Ulithi consists of a large atoll, with 183 square miles (474 square kilometers) of lagoon and some detached reefs and islets (very small islands). The land area totals less than 2 square miles (5 square kilometers). About 710 Micronesians live on the islets. They raise food for their own use and make copra for trade.

The United States took control of Ulithi as part of a United Nations trusteeship in 1947. In 1980, Ulithi and other Caroline Islands formed the Federated States of Micronesia. In 1986, these islands became a self-governing political unit in free association with the United States.
